How they compare
SDG: Central and Southern Asia currently reports 1.84 million against 7,966 in Eswatini, a difference of 1.83 million.
That makes SDG: Central and Southern Asia's figure about 230.6 times Eswatini's.
Across all 19 years both countries report, SDG: Central and Southern Asia has been ahead every year.
Eswatini ranks 90th and SDG: Central and Southern Asia ranks 88th of 201 countries.
SDG: Central and Southern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Eswatini | SDG: Central and Southern Asia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 5,518 | 3.37 million | 3.36 million | SDG: Central and Southern Asia |
| 2010s | 7,828 | 1.48 million | 1.47 million | SDG: Central and Southern Asia |
| 2020s | 6,170 | 1.29 million | 1.29 million | SDG: Central and Southern Asia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
